Wealth, poverty and compassion: The rich are... →
Jul 29th 2010
LIFE at the bottom is nasty, brutish and short. For this reason,
heartless folk might assume that people in the lower social classes
will be more self-interested and less inclined to consider the
welfare of others than upper-class individuals, who can afford a
certain noblesse oblige. A recent study, however,
challenges this idea.
